Not in an icky way. Ryan Seacrest thinks that Lindsay Lohan is TV worthy, and is looking to participate in his new series. According to Lindsay Lohan's tweet, she's "Working on a really great project for television- I am excited! Something meaningful like Extreme Home Makeover on ABC."
A source told RadarOnline.com, "Ryan thinks Lindsay would be a great way to start the series, and Lindsay thinks it will help rehabilitate her image."
Ryan was trying to seal the deal with her (so to speak) this past Thursday night. Ryan partied up the night with Lindsay. They their evening at Chateau Marmont for dinner, followed by nightspot h.wood, then a stint at Lohan's Hollywood Hills home before the pair finished the evening Seacrest's pad--around 6 a.m.
